18.2
Removal of the Ignition and detection
electrodes
Warning: isolate the boiler from the mains
electricity supply before removing any
covering or component.
1
Remove all the case panels and the sealed
chamber lid (see section 2) .
2
Disconnect the ignition electrodes connector
F
and the earth wire
G
from the spark generator
(Fig. 18.1) and disconnect the detection elec-
trode connector
H
.
3
Unscrew the screws
I
and remove the ignition
electrodes B and the detection electrode D
(Fig. 18.1).
4
Assemble the Ignition and detection electrodes
carrying out the removal operation in reverse or-
der.
When reassembling the ignition electrodes be sure
to connect correctly the wires to the spark genera-
tor (see Fig. 18.3)
